Engineering Microbes: Norway's Breakthrough in Converting CO2 to High-Purity Biomethane

Scientists at the Norwegian Institute of BIOeconomy Research (NIBIO) have achieved a significant milestone in sustainable energy, converting carbon-based gases like CO2 directly into biomethane with 96% purity. The core of their innovation is the strategic engineering of biofilms—complex communities of microorganisms that adhere to a surface. Unlike traditional biogas plants that rely on general decomposition, this process uses the biofilm to perform a targeted conversion of gas streams into nearly pure methane. ...
